One thing that immediately stands out is how Taylor’s career began with the Cleveland Rockers, a team that ultimately folded. This could have been a career-derailing setback for many players, but for Taylor, it was a pivot point. Being part of the dispersal draft and landing in Phoenix wasn’t just a change of scenery—it was the beginning of a legacy. What many people don’t realize is that the WNBA’s early years were fraught with instability, with teams folding and players left in limbo. Taylor’s ability to thrive in this environment speaks volumes about her mental toughness and adaptability.

Her early years in Cleveland were a quiet prelude to what would become a stellar career. Coming off the bench in her rookie season, she still managed to average solid numbers, which, in my opinion, foreshadowed her potential. But it was her transition to a starting role in her second season that truly set the stage. What this really suggests is that Taylor wasn’t just a talented player—she was a quick learner who could adjust to increasing responsibilities.

The 2007 season, however, is where Taylor’s star truly shone. Averaging a career-high 17.8 points and leading the Mercury to a championship against the defending champs? That’s the stuff of legend. What makes this particularly fascinating is how she managed to peak at a time when the team needed her most. If you take a step back and think about it, this wasn’t just about individual brilliance—it was about leadership and timing.

But here’s a detail that I find especially interesting: Taylor’s career wasn’t without its setbacks. She missed the 2008 season entirely, and the Mercury struggled without her. Yet, in 2009, she returned to help the team secure another championship. This raises a deeper question: How do athletes maintain their edge after significant absences? Taylor’s comeback wasn’t just physical—it was a mental triumph, proving that resilience is as crucial as talent.
